Labor Expenses



When it pertains to working with a residence painter, recognizing labor prices is critical for budgeting efficiently. The labor expenses can differ considerably based upon numerous elements, consisting of the painter's experience, your location, and the intricacy of the work. Normally, you can anticipate to pay between $25 and $75 per hour for professional painters, but this can change.

Prior to hiring, you'll want to get price quotes from numerous painters. This gives you a more clear picture of the going rates in your area. Do not neglect to inquire about their experience and previous work to ensure you're spending for top quality. Furthermore, think about whether you intend to hire a solo painter or a group; groups may finish the task quicker however can charge higher rates.

Bear in mind that some painters could use flat-rate prices instead of hourly rates. This can be valuable for budgeting, as it enables you to understand the complete expense upfront. Ensure pro painters clarify what's consisted of because rate-- some painters could charge additional for prep job or cleanup.

Understanding these details will help you avoid shocks and make notified choices throughout the painting procedure.

Product Expenses



Material expenses play a substantial role in the general price of employing a house painter. When you're budgeting for your paint job, you'll require to make up different materials that go into the job. These normally consist of paint, guide, and any kind of needed materials like brushes, rollers, and painter's tape.

The sort of paint you choose can significantly affect your expenditures. High-quality paints often cost extra upfront, but they can offer much better insurance coverage and resilience, saving you money in the long run. You could additionally intend to take into consideration whether you require specialty paints, such as mildew-resistant or low-VOC choices, which can include in your expenses.

Furthermore, if your home calls for repair work prior to paint-- like patching openings or sanding surface areas-- those materials will also add to your total amount.

Do not forget the cost of drop cloths, ladders, and various other protective equipment the painter will use to guard your home furnishings and floors.

Additional Fees and Factors To Consider



Additional charges can dramatically affect your overall spending plan when working with a house painter. As an example, you might come across prices for traveling if the painter has to drive a significant distance to your place. This charge can differ based upon distance and might be included in the final bill.

An additional usual consideration is the expense of preparation work. If your wall surfaces require fixings, such as patching openings or fining sand surfaces, these jobs typically feature additional costs. See to it to discuss this with your painter in advance to stay clear of surprises.



You need to likewise ask about the type of paint they intend to make use of. If you choose high-quality or specialty paints, be gotten ready for a rate rise. Furthermore, some painters bill for cleanup services post-job, so clarify if this is included in the first price quote.
